Tournament Rules

  1. An individual can only have one partner for the tournament and cannot play on more than one team.
  2. Each game will be played to 21 points, or a 20 minute time limit, whichever comes first.
  3. There is a foul line at the front of the boards. When throwing a bag, contestant must be behind the line, and cannot cross it. If they do, the thrown bag will be removed and not counted in the round.
  4. Contestant must throw from the side of the cornhole boards.
  5. To start the game, a coin toss will be used to determine who throws first. The team which wins the coin toss picks who throws first; the losing team picks their sides of the boards. Players alternate throws. After the start of the game, the last team who has scored will throw first in the next round.

 

Tournament Scoring

One point will be awarded for a bag that rests on a cornhole board without touching the ground.

Three points will be awarded for a bag that lands in the hole of the boards.

If a bag comes into contact with the ground at any time (skips to the board, slides off, or is on the edge and touching the ground), it is zero points

Once the arm has made forward momentum past the hip, the bag thrown will count as a throw. No re-throws will be awarded.

We will be using cancellation scoring. Cornhole bags in the hole and bags on the board by opponents during a round cancel each other out. Only non-canceled bags are counted in the score for the round (for example, Team A has two bags in the hole and one on the board; Team B has two bags in the hole; Team A would be awarded one point).

If a team goes over 21 points, they will return to their score from the previous round (for example: Team A has 19 points, earns 3 points in the round, their score remains 19 and game play continues)

Teams will be responsible for using the score cards provided for keeping track of scores during a game.
